Abstract

This paper details the core of the high-order $\pmb{TE_{62}}$ mode generator components – the coaxial resonant cavity. In order to obtain high purity $\pmb{TE_{62}}$ mode and improve the isolation among the modes, we use a cavity with an improved coaxial structure. The slowly variable section open coaxial cavity structure can make the $\pmb{TE_{62}}$ mode well separated from its nearby modes. In this paper, the influence of the inner and outer radii of the coaxial cavity on the resonant frequency is presented. The $\pmb{TE_{62}}$ mode purity of the cavity was calculated by the MATLAB program to be 95.3% and the result of the HFSS simulation after the optimization design of the W-band high-purity $\pmb{TE_{62}}$ mode cavity is given, which is in close agreement with the ideal field distribution.
